Who Are We?

Concerto Renal Services is an industry leader in sub‑acute hemodialysis within a skilled nursing facility and/or long‑term care facility. We are a rapidly expanding business with a simple mission: reimagining dialysis care, one community at a time. Our model focuses on ensuring those with end‑stage renal disease receive the best possible care through a more convenient, centralized, continuous care model.

Why is this Role Essential?

Concerto is seeking a PRN Dialysis Technician to join its team! The PRN Dialysis Technician functions as part of the hemodialysis healthcare team in providing safe and effective dialysis therapy for patients. The technician works under the supervision of a licensed nurse in accordance with Concerto’s policies, procedures, and training and in compliance with regulations set by state and federal agencies.

Responsibilities
  • Direct Patient Care – Provides hands‑on care to assigned patients under the supervision of a licensed nurse, including initiating and discontinuing dialysis treatments per prescribed orders.
  • Vital Signs & Monitoring – Obtains and documents pre‑ and post‑treatment vitals, weight, and vascular access assessments, reporting any unusual findings to the nurse.
  • Dialysis Machine Operation – Sets up, operates, and performs safety checks on hemodialysis machines; administers heparin as permitted by state law.
  • Documentation & Lab Work – Accurately documents patient treatment details and prepares laboratory specimens as prescribed.
  • Customer Service & Environment – Delivers excellent service to patients, families, and staff, while maintaining a clean and safe work environment.
